Key Health Challenges Facing Men
Physical Health Concerns
Men are more likely to develop serious health conditions such as heart disease, prostate cancer, and diabetes. These health issues often go unnoticed until they reach advanced stages, but with proper awareness and early intervention, many of these conditions can be managed effectively. Regular check-ups, healthy eating habits, and exercise are vital in preventing and managing these physical health challenges.
Mental Health Matters
Mental health is a crucial yet often overlooked aspect of men’s health. Men sometimes face societal pressures to be strong and stoic, leading many to bottle up emotions and avoid seeking help. This can lead to depression, anxiety, and, in extreme cases, suicide. Opening up about mental health, seeking therapy, and reducing the stigma surrounding mental health can make a world of difference in the well-being of men.
Social and Lifestyle Factors
Beyond medical conditions, the way men live can also affect their health. Unhealthy lifestyle choices such as smoking, heavy drinking, and poor diet contribute to preventable illnesses. Encouraging men to lead balanced lives, form healthy habits, and engage in positive social activities can significantly improve their health outcomes.
Promoting Men’s Health: Small Steps, Big Impact
Regular Health Screenings
Health screenings are not just for the elderly – regular check-ups can catch issues early, when they are easier to manage. Prostate exams, cholesterol checks, and mental health evaluations are just a few examples of how men can take control of their health before problems arise.
Breaking the Silence on Mental Health
It’s time to normalize conversations about mental health. Men deserve to talk openly about their struggles, whether it’s feeling stressed, overwhelmed, or anxious. Mental health support is available, and by encouraging men to reach out, we can help prevent more severe outcomes and foster a supportive environment for emotional well-being.
Leading by Example: Healthy Lifestyles
Leading by example can inspire men to take better care of their bodies. Whether it’s through engaging in physical activities or making healthier food choices, small changes can lead to lasting impacts. A balanced diet, regular exercise, and cutting out harmful substances like tobacco and excessive alcohol can reduce the risks of chronic diseases and improve quality of life.
Health Concern | Recommended Action |
---|---|
Heart Disease | Regular exercise, healthy diet, and blood pressure checks |
Mental Health | Open discussions, therapy, and stress management practices |
Prostate Cancer | Routine screenings, early detection, and a healthy lifestyle |
Diabetes | Regular monitoring of blood sugar, healthy eating habits |

FAQs
Why is men’s health awareness so important?
Men’s health awareness helps identify health issues early and encourages men to adopt healthier habits, preventing chronic diseases and improving overall well-being.
How can men improve their mental health?
Men can improve their mental health by talking openly about their feelings, seeking professional help when needed, and participating in stress-reducing activities like exercise or hobbies.
What are the top health screenings men should get?
Men should prioritize screenings for heart disease, diabetes, prostate cancer, and mental health assessments to stay on top of their health.
